Output 5839e24b418b633f71be33c2f80eb0b2dafc25bb7f5926456467a41e343f5a5f:0

value
39881920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96050296a8db69dee443ac3d28128321f5371981 OP_EQUALVERIFY OP_CHECKSIG
address
1EgEMtE6pEmhhFGgNqiqV3bhbonES1LkrX
transaction
5839e24b418b633f71be33c2f80eb0b2dafc25bb7f5926456467a41e343f5a5f
spent
true